What are the benefits of using Continuous Glucose Monitoring (CGM)?
- Know your sensor glucose readings with just a glance at your phone:** Unlike blood glucose meters, which require a deliberate action to get a reading, a CGM system works continuously all day, even while you are asleep. Your Dexcom CGM can provide you with 288 glucose readings every day, direct to your smartphone. The app will display your current glucose level and where it is heading; up, down, and at what pace. You can get the full picture of your glucose levels & trends, all day every day.
- Get one step closer to better diabetes management1,2,3: Dexcom CGM technology can help you achieve your diabetes treatment goals. With Continuous Glucose Monitoring, you get the full picture of your glucose levels. You can see in real time how things such as food, exercise or stress affect your levels. It can help you make timely treatment decisions and avoid those rollercoaster highs and lows.
- Helps to reduce1,2 hypoglycaemia - day and night: When activated, the low glucose alert can warn you if you are falling below your pre-set low glucose levels, so you can take the necessary action. You can select the low threshold that suits you best and customise the alert sound or vibration.
